The BOSCH 8733980512 is a multi-zone ductless mini split system rated at 27000 BTU/h total cooling and heating capacity across three indoor zones. This kit includes two 9000 BTU/h indoor units and one 18000 BTU/h indoor unit paired with a single outdoor condensing unit, allowing independent temperature control in up to three separate spaces from one outdoor installation. The system ships without a line set, so line sets must be sourced separately to match the actual installation distances. Licensed HVAC technicians install this equipment in residential and light commercial applications.
This multi-zone system is suited for residential homes, condos, apartments, and light commercial spaces where ductwork is impractical or unavailable. The three-zone configuration supports mixed room sizes — pairing the two smaller 9000 BTU/h heads for bedrooms or offices with the larger 18000 BTU/h head for a living area or open space. The absence of an included line set makes it adaptable to installations where run lengths vary by job.
This kit is designed as a matched multi-zone ductless system. Component part numbers included in this kit are indoor units 8733962672 (quantity 2) and 8733962674 (quantity 1), and outdoor unit 8733962700 (quantity 1). No additional compatible model numbers were specified in the product data.
Installation must be performed by a licensed HVAC technician holding EPA Section 608 certification, as this system involves refrigerant handling. Disconnect all power at the breaker before making any electrical connections to indoor or outdoor units. Line sets, electrical whips, and disconnect boxes are not included and must be sized according to the equipment specifications and applicable local codes. Follow the manufacturer installation manual for refrigerant line sizing, flaring procedures, and nitrogen pressure testing before charging.
